Analysis
In 2005, ducks — amount excreted in manure in Serbia and Montenegro stood at 490,779 kg. That is the highest value across all 14 years on record.
That represents a change of up 11.1% on the previous year and up 15.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, ducks — amount excreted in manure in Serbia and Montenegro peaked at 490,779 kg in 2005 and was at its lowest, 368,084 kg, in 1993.
Serbia and Montenegro ranks 41st of 94 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 14 years of available data.

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
